read moreThe NSW Government has announced that VenuesLive, the operator of Sydney's ANZ Stadium and Optus Stadium in Perth will oversee day-to-day management of the new Western Sydney Stadium which is under construction on the site of the former Parramatta Stadium.
The contract will see VenuesLive managing events and catering, securing event content and ticketing.
Annoucing the significan project milestone, NSW Minister for Sport Stuart Ayres advised "in a little over a year we will deliver a world class entertainment precinct that will inject millions of dollars into the Western Sydney economy and redine the fan experience.
“Western Sydney is no stranger to showing the rest of Sydney how it is done and this stadium will be no different, it will attract top name acts and sporting blockbusters and boast the latest technology and seats closer to action than ever before.
VenuesLive Chief Executive Daryl Kerry added “VenuesLive is delighted to be partnering with the NSW Government to operate Western Sydney Stadium, which will set new standards in live sport and entertainment when it opens in 2019.
“We will leverage our team’s extensive management and operations expertise to introduce world-class events in Western Sydney and deliver a truly fans-first live sport experience.”
Venues NSW Chair Christine McLoughlin also stated “VenuesLive has demonstrated its capability to deliver fantastic events and outstanding venue management, and we are excited to be working with VenuesLive as we look toward the opening of Western Sydney Stadium.”
Western Sydney Stadium is being delivered by Infrastructure NSW in close partnership with Venues NSW, the owner and promoter of a portfolio of publicly-owned sports and entertainment venues in NSW.
